You pretty much have to have a machine shop to make all the parts I've got a buddy that works at a machine shop and he has luckily been smart enough to rebuild what little I have broke on mine they are pretty damn tough and hard to stop as long as you have momentum ill get you some pics of mine it was built by a guy in Georgia he built 5 of them and they all were different in little ways than others on the rear arms I've been around a lot of chaindrives and what I've seen they are really just extravagantly home made things. They also make the ones they call baby chains as well and they are just modified factory rear arms on the factory torsion with an extension made to the arms with an offset deal at the bottom that the lower axel goes through to tighten the chains weird but works.
